友情提示:欢迎光临!本地已启用二维码api网关,地址是https://api.slogra.com

shell多进程scp传文件

post by rocdk890 / 2015-9-9 16:55 Wednesday linux技术

  昨天给大家了一个shell多进程并发, 今天我们来看怎么同时批量在定义数量的服务器上执行相关命令,比起普通for/while循环只能顺序一条一条执行的效率高非常多,在管理大批服务器时非 常的实用.以下脚本功能是通过scp(也可选rsync)向上千台服务器传更新包,脚本运行后同时在后台有50个scp进程向服务器传包:

#!/bin/bash
ip=`cat iplist.txt|grep -v "#"|awk '{print $1}'`
dir='/usr/local/src'
answer="yes"     #定义yes/no应答变量
passwd="123456"  #服务器密码
thead_num=5...

阅读全文>>

标签: shell 文件 scp 传输 flie 多进程

评论(0) 引用(0) 浏览(5170)

用fifo来处理shell下的多进程并发

post by rocdk890 / 2015-9-8 10:42 Tuesday linux技术

 今天看到个不错的shell多进程并发脚本的讲解,现共享给大家:

#!/bin/bash
#author :  peterguo@tencent.com
#date   :  2013.05.24
 
#sub process do something
function a_sub_process { 
    echo "processing in pid [$$]"
    sleep 1
}
 
#创建一个fifo文件...

阅读全文>>

标签: linux shell 并发 fifo 多进程

评论(0) 引用(0) 浏览(6071)